Shoulders should be visible, and there should be enough space around the head for cropping the photo.A person’s passport is a vital possession.Position the camera in the same height as the head.Facial features: Have a neutral facial expression.You can use additional light source to get even lighting on the face. Face the light source such as a window to remove shadows on the face. Adjust the distance to the wall to remove shadows on the background. Lighting: Make sure there are no shadows on your face or on the background.Make sure that there are no other objects in the background. Seen with flash reflection on face/glasses The photograph will not be accepted if the applicant in the photograph is: ![]() When you take the photo, please do not wear head dress, and avoid heavy make-upĪnd overly dark or overly light-coloured clothing. The size fromĬhin to crown for the person in the photograph should be 32mm to 36mm. The size of the photograph must be 40mm (width) X 50mm (height). The photograph should have a plain white background. The photograph should show your full frontal face with clear facial features. Hong Kong Passport Photo Size Requirements
